Edging is the practice of developing tidy, specified limits between various landscape components, such as yards, garden beds, paths, and outdoor patios. Correct edging improves the visual appeal of a home, prevents grass from intruding into flower beds, and makes maintenance jobs like trimming simpler and more accurate. Methods consist of setting up physical barriers like metal, plastic, or stone edging, along with forming soil or turf to create natural boundaries. Product option and installation approaches vary depending on the desired aesthetic, landscape style, and long-lasting resilience. Routine upkeep of edges avoids overgrowth, maintains crisp lines, and contributes to a sleek, deliberate appearance. Reliable edging is both a useful tool and a style component, improving the overall organization and appeal of a landscape
